Output 29b66473fd51f37dfc9aa12519debb1e1aa18d2d897e8975d2af0a86c5fce2cb:0

value
502633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b441e3d801aeb04004a5d3f743494392601520 OP_EQUAL
address
33aVNtAJjYmYjyvwTMZAQsiHvjU2w7dKuc
transaction
29b66473fd51f37dfc9aa12519debb1e1aa18d2d897e8975d2af0a86c5fce2cb
spent
true